The Flavors of Life
Sugar's sweet and it's a treat that just can't be
denied
good for eatin' but left unsweetened bananas
can be fried
Savored things like onion rings can be a little
tempting
eat it not what you ain't got and you'll be a little
empty
Lemon sour has the power to draw a puckered
face
a twenty layered chocolate cake will leave you
full for days
Ice cubes are good for things but not for taking
baths
coconuts can be hard to pick unless you're a
giraffe
Life is filled with seasonings like even salt and
pepper
seasons come and seasons go and always
will forever
